vmware_host_capability_facts – Gathers facts about an ESXi host’s capability information
New in version 2.6.
Synopsis
- This module can be used to gather facts about an ESXi host’s capability information when ESXi hostname or Cluster name is given.
Requirements
The below requirements are needed on the host that executes this module.
- python >= 2.6
- PyVmomi

Examples
- name: Gather capability facts about all ESXi Host in given Cluster
vmware_host_capability_facts:
hostname: '{{ vcenter_hostname }}'
username: '{{ vcenter_username }}'
password: '{{ vcenter_password }}'
cluster_name: cluster_name
delegate_to: localhost
register: all_cluster_hosts_facts
- name: Gather capability facts about ESXi Host
vmware_host_capability_facts:
hostname: '{{ vcenter_hostname }}'
username: '{{ vcenter_username }}'
password: '{{ vcenter_password }}'
esxi_hostname: '{{ esxi_hostname }}'
delegate_to: localhost
register: hosts_facts
Return Values
Common return values are documented here, the following are the fields unique to this module:
Key | Returned | Description |
---|---|---|
hosts_capability_facts dictionary |
always |
metadata about host's capability information
Sample: {'esxi_hostname_0001': {'accel3dSupported': False, 'backgroundSnapshotsSupported': False, 'checkpointFtCompatibilityIssues': [], 'checkpointFtSupported': False, 'cloneFromSnapshotSupported': True, 'cpuHwMmuSupported': True}} |
